All that is, is the "on-off" switch built into a mic, which turns off the tape motor to pause recording. It's not really a remote control in the sense that you'd expect. Most "shoebox" style tape recorders have the same remote jack.
The mics which came with tape recorders had a double plug, where one side was for the mic, and the smaller plug for the remote. The hole beside the mic jack, is the place to stick the remote side of the double plug on the channel you are not actually using the remote - i.e. if you want to use the remote switch on the left channel, then it would plug into the left "mic" jack and the "remote" jack, while the right plug would go into the right "mic" jack, and its remote prong into the empty hole.
